    Date formating probelm

    Shortly: is there a way to convert date-time data in format MDY HH:MM to format Y M D HH MM SS?

    So that years, months, days, hours, minutes and seconds would be in their own columns. (Seconds would be zeroes in this case but I want the column to be there.) Maybe the following example data demonstrates my need best.

    I have MDY data as follows:



    09/24/08 13:16
    09/24/08 13:17
    09/24/08 13:18



    I would like the data above to be in format Y M D H MM SS:

    2008 09 24 13 16 00
    2008 09 24 13 17 00
    2008 09 24 13 18 00

    if A1 holds date:

    B1 = YEAR(A1)
    C1 = MONTH(A1)
    D1 = DAY(A1)
    E1 = HOUR(A1)
    F1 = MINUTE(A1)
    G1 = SECOND(A1)

    Format to display leading zeroes as required -- eg month custom format of mm, seconds would be ss etc...
